State PSC exams are similar in stature to the UPSC Civil Services Examination, but their jurisdiction is limited to a particular state. Officers recruited through PSC exams work as:
Sub-Divisional Magistrates (SDM)
Deputy Superintendent of Police (DSP)
Deputy Collectors
Block Development Officers (BDO)
Assistant Commissioners, Registrars, and more
These officers are the backbone of state governance, responsible for law and order, revenue administration, development programs, and policy execution at the grassroots level.
UPPCS Examination 2026 (Uttar Pradesh PSC)
The UPPCS exam, conducted by the Uttar Pradesh Public Service Commission (UPPSC), is one of the most prestigious state civil services examinations in India.
Selection Process
Preliminary Exam – General Studies & CSAT (Objective)
Mains Exam – Descriptive papers (Hindi, Essay, GS Papers, Optional)
Interview
Syllabus Focus
Current Affairs (National & UP-specific)
History, Polity, Geography, Economy
Environment, Science & Technology
UPPCS officers play a direct role in district administration and public service delivery, making this exam extremely competitive.
BPSC Combined Competitive Examination 2026
The BPSC Exam, conducted by the Bihar Public Service Commission, is Bihar’s top administrative recruitment exam.
Key Posts
Deputy Collector
DSP
Revenue Officer
Exam Stages
Prelims (Objective)
Mains (Descriptive)
Interview
Preparation Insight
The syllabus emphasizes Bihar-specific history, economy, and governance, along with national topics. Practicing BPSC previous year question papers is essential to understand evolving trends.
RPSC RAS Examination 2026 (Rajasthan)
The Rajasthan Administrative Service (RAS) exam is conducted by the Rajasthan Public Service Commission (RPSC).
Exam Structure
Prelims – General Knowledge & Science
Mains – GS I, II, III + Hindi & English
Interview
Special Focus Areas
Rajasthan History, Culture, Geography
Indian Constitution and Economy
RAS officers are key decision-makers in state policy implementation and district-level governance.
MPPSC State Service Examination 2026
The MPPSC PCS Exam, conducted by the Madhya Pradesh Public Service Commission, recruits officers for Madhya Pradesh’s administrative services.
Stages
Prelims (GS & CSAT)
Mains (Descriptive papers)
Interview
Why MPPSC Is Unique
MPPSC balances state-specific and national issues, making conceptual clarity crucial. Regular revision and answer-writing practice are vital for success.
TNPSC Group 1 Examination 2026
The TNPSC Group 1 Exam, conducted by the Tamil Nadu Public Service Commission, is Tamil Nadu’s top civil services examination.
Posts Recruited
Deputy Collector
DSP
Assistant Commissioner
Syllabus Highlights
Tamil Nadu History & Culture
Indian Polity & Economy
Current Affairs
TNPSC Group 1 is known for strict evaluation standards and in-depth state focus, requiring disciplined preparation.
WBCS Examination 2026 (West Bengal)
The WBCS Exam, conducted by the West Bengal Public Service Commission, recruits officers for Group A, B, C, and D services.
Selection Process
Prelims
Mains (Compulsory + Optional Papers)
Personality Test
Career Scope
WBCS offers diverse roles in administration, police, revenue, and labor services, making it one of the most sought-after state exams in eastern India.
MPSC Rajyaseva Examination 2026 (Maharashtra)
The MPSC Rajyaseva Exam, conducted by the Maharashtra Public Service Commission, recruits officers for Maharashtra’s administrative machinery.
Exam Pattern
Prelims – GS & CSAT
Mains – Language + GS Papers
Interview
Preparation Strategy
Strong command over Maharashtra history, geography, and polity, along with national current affairs, is critical for clearing MPSC.
How to Prepare for PSC Exams 2026 Effectively
Understand State-Specific Syllabus
Unlike UPSC, PSC exams heavily emphasize state history, culture, economy, and governance.
Practice Previous Year Papers
PYQs help identify:
Repeated topics
Question trends
Difficulty level
Answer Writing & Revision
Regular answer writing improves clarity, structure, and speed, especially for Mains exams.
Consistent Current Affairs
Focus on both national and state-level current events for maximum scoring potential.
